I found this while surfing for ships that might be carrying Subarus. The article is dated today.

"A cargo ship carrying more than 2,800 brand new cars has sunk after colliding with another vessel in the fog-bound English Channel.

The Tricolor, a Norwegian-registered car carrier, had 2,862 motor cars on board and 77 containers when it collided with the Kariba, a container ship, 30 miles east of Ramsgate.
The Tricolor had picked up its cargo in Zebrugge, Belgium and was on its way to Southampton, said Per Ronnevig, spokesman for its owners, shipping firm Wilhelmsen Lines.

Mr Ronnevig said, "We do not yet have a figure for the value of the cargo. We are working on the figures now. It will be several million dollars certainly. "The ship was carrying new cars but we are not sure what make they were yet."
